Large Airports ...
- Lambert - St. Louis Intl. (STL/KSTL)
(74 miles [119.1 km] to the southwest)
- Indianapolis Intl. (IND/KIND)
(161 miles [259.1 km] to the east)
- Midway Intl. (MDW/KMDW)
(182 miles [292.9 km] to the north northeast)
- O'Hare Intl. (ORD/KORD)
(190 miles [305.8 km] to the north northeast)
- Rockford Intl. (RFD/KRFD)
(191 miles [307.4 km] to the north)
- Louisville Intl. (SDF/KSDF)
(210 miles [338 km] to the east southeast)
